"How to optimize dark scenes in ARC Raiders using GamePP's AI filters?"

AI Filters

1. Open the "Game Filters" module and go to the "Display Settings" tab; 2. Drag the dark scene balance adjustment slider from 0%-100%; 3. Preview image quality with real-time examples; 4. Launch ARC Raiders and press Shift+F6 to toggle AI filters.

"How to adjust color saturation for N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5090 with GamePP AI filters?"

AI Filters

1. Open the "Game Filters" module and go to the "Display Settings" tab; 2. Drag the graphics card digital vibrance slider from 0%-100%; 3. Compare previews before and after; 4. Adapt for N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5090 to avoid color distortion.
